Marie Curie fundraisers in Warrington want to thank everyone involved in making the 2017 Great Daffodil Appeal a great success.

The month long fundraising appeal, which launched on March 1, saw lots of local volunteers out collecting donations for the charity, in return for a daffodil pin. All funds raised throughout the month will help Marie Curie provide support to people living with a terminal illness and their loved ones.

Kaylie Chapman, Community Fundraiser said: “We would like to say a big thank you to everyone in Warrington for helping to make every daffodil count this March.

“Your support from donating or being one of our amazing volunteers who collected donations, means that we can help and support people who are living with a terminal illness.

“Thank you for helping make a difference to people at the end of their lives at a time when they need it most.”
